Calif. candidate won't quit if charged
Oct 24 2006 9:29PM (CT)
GARDEN GROVE, Calif. (AP) - A Republican congressional candidate whose campaign was linked to an intimidating letter sent to Hispanic voters said Tuesday he would not quit the race if he is charged with a crime.

Officials scrutinize Ariz. land deal
Oct 24 2006 8:30PM (CT)
WASHINGTON (AP) - A land deal involving Rep. Rick Renzi, R-Ariz., is being scrutinized by the U.S. attorney's office in Arizona, a law enforcement official in Washington said Tuesday.

Wyo. candidate apologizes for remark
Oct 24 2006 6:20PM (CT)
CHEYENNE, Wyo. (AP) - Rep. Barbara Cubin, a Republican seeking re-election in a close race for Wyoming's only House seat, publicly apologized Tuesday for a comment she made to a disabled opponent after a testy debate.

Scandals in 2 states may affect Ky. race
Oct 24 2006 6:08PM (CT)
COVINGTON, Ky. (AP) - To the north of this river town, Ohio Gov. Bob Taft has pleaded no contest to ethics violations. To the south, Kentucky Gov. Ernie Fletcher has acknowledged that people working for him may have wrongly rewarded political supporters with jobs. Two states, two damaged administrations, and two Republican governors.
